What is the role of mycorrhizae in plant ecology?
Correct Answer: Mycorrhizae enhance nutrient absorption for plants, particularly phosphorus.
- Step 1: Understand that mycorrhizae are special fungi that live in the soil.
- Step 2: Know that these fungi form a partnership with plant roots.
- Step 3: Realize that mycorrhizae help plants absorb nutrients from the soil.
- Step 4: Focus on phosphorus, which is an important nutrient for plant growth.
- Step 5: Remember that with more phosphorus, plants can grow healthier and stronger.
- Step 6: Conclude that mycorrhizae play a crucial role in helping plants thrive in their environment.
